Wyoming Takes Lead as First State Issues Its Own Stablecoin

In a groundbreaking move, Wyoming has become the first U.S. state to issue its own stablecoin, the Frontier Stable Token (FRNT). This historic initiative, spearheaded by the Wyoming Stable Token Commission led by Governor Mark Gordon, aims to revolutionize financial operations and enhance blockchain technology accessibility. FRNT is fully backed by USD and short-term Treasurys, offering a high degree of stability. It will be deployed on major blockchains including Ethereum and Solana, allowing for widespread adoption and utilization. This pioneering step in the U.S. landscape could trigger further innovations from other states, potentially transforming the way digital currency operates across the nation.
